This has not been fixed yet for Beta 3

Same problem in your TabControl!
 
You must Check the "Ambient.UserMode" inside your container-controls. If True then allow to disable the control (!)
Because...
Ambient.UserMode = True (control works in RunTime)
Ambient.UserMode = False (control works in the IDE)
